Default Marantz SR5003 or SR6003 or SR7002?

Hello, im just getting crazy to make a right choice, well definitely Marantz is the right choice, but i don't know what model is better.

My budget is US$500.00 i was determined get the Marantz SR5003 but looking arround i found other marantz options as the SR6003 for US$649.99 refurbished (i don't like refurbished) but now i found the marantz SR7002 BRAND NEW for US$699.99 (regular price for this is between US$900.00 to US$1,200.00) i could wait more time to collect more money and get this one but i don't know if it worthwhile.

The Elites should be announced sometime over the summer. I'd be a little nervous about getting a new model Marantz after the issue with the pop of death with the 5004 and 6004 receivers especially due to the way Marantz responded to the problem which amounted to denial and refusal of warranty coverage.

Anyone considering Marantz should look at the previous *003 and *002 models only for the time being. The upcoming *005 models should be looked at with caution, and the current *004 models should be avoided altogether.
